以下是流程: -
page:-1从dojo DateTextBox中选择日期并提交页面。有几个文本字段和日期文本框。
第2页: - 查看第1页中提交的值。可以选择使用javascript History.back()
返回问题: - 当我返回其他文本框时保留其值但dojo DateTextField无法预填充原始值。
当调用History.back()时,如何让dojo组件记住它的值?
我知道History.back()函数从浏览器缓存中呈现页面。
谢谢, 的Manoj
答案 0 :(得分:0)
文本框将其值记住为浏览器的一项功能。 Dijit不会这样做,因为浏览器对此一无所知。您必须编写自定义代码并通过cookie记住设置,并将窗口小部件设置为页面加载(或在窗口小部件实例化)上的cookie值。